Power connectors promise fast and safe mating

Neptune Series power connectors have been developed for fast and safe interconnections between modular equipment operating in demanding environments.

Amphenol Industrial Operations has introduced its new Neptune Series power connectors - featuring Radsok technology.

Developed for fast and safe interconnections between modular equipment operating in demanding environments, like those found in onshore and offshore oil exploration, power generation, manufacturing plants etc, they are also ideal for any portable power equipment dependant on secure power interconnects.

Neptune high-integrity plug and receptacles are offered from 30 up to 400A at 600V and feature the company's exclusive Radsok contact system that allows greater current and voltage to be accommodated through smaller connectors.

The lightweight aluminium hardware is precision machined from high tensile strength stock and finished with a hard coating to 40 points on the Rockwell C scale.

The result is a rugged, environmentally sealed, high-reliability IP68-8 rated connector, with a dielectric strength of 1800V, that is some 50% smaller and lighter than competing products.

Amphenol Industrial Operations offers its Neptune Series in a range of sizes from 12 to 4/0 and 350MCM.

The advanced Radsok contact system that delivers the superior performance is a patented electrical terminal based on a hyperbolic grid configuration.

The cylinders contain elongated contactor strips connected in spaced parallel relationships and twisted into a hyperbolic shape.

As a male pin is inserted the grid deflects and imparts high normal forces.

The hyperbolic configuration ensures a large coaxial, face-to-face engagement area for a low millivolt drop connection with low insertion force.

Its stamped grid and cylinder are rugged and forgiving to maintain integrity over a high number of connection cycles and off-axis insertions.

The Neptune Series connectors have interchangeable and reversible contact inserts to suit specific needs.

These contacts are made of copper, silver-plated as standard but with gold-plating as an option.

Conductors are readily terminated to easily accessible pressure wire terminals.

Cable housings with ample wiring space slip over the conductors after termination, eliminating the cumbersome handling and seating of inserts with conductors attached.

The new Neptune Series is compatible with armoured and sheathed cable of IEEE45/UL1309, IEC, BS, DIN and JIC standard and unarmoured and flexible cables including S, SO, SOOW-A, W, G-GC.
